GM: Rep changes during the session
So I've run my first session.. my first two sessions now actually. This is my first ever attempts at GMing roleplaying games and it seems to be going well so far. :) Curious about one thing however... rep changes. I kinda like the idea that theres always someone who sees the player's actions, and this feedback virally propagates over the mesh and has an impact on the PC's reputation levels. For example, one of my players (who is doing the EP equivalent of being a leading fashion designer and spent tons of CP at character creation on pumping rep levels to be really high) is acting like a sort of visiting celebrity.... she put out the call on the @-list and fame networks for a place to stay, and as part of that she started doing this livestreaming fashion show where was doing makeovers for a couple of people who offered to put her up. I'm curious about what sorts of things you guys think should happen with rep, based on players actions such as this. I can see that, obviously, this sort of behaviour should be noticed and should have some impact, but the question is.. how much? how soon? What do you all think? How do you guys deal with it?

Re: GM: Rep changes during the session
The book does describe how much rep should be earned for what sort of activities. I'm comfortable with it being applied immediately, or a few hours after the activity. I don't generally go TOO into rep, since it's easy to fall into traps ('you hosted it at Weiss Hall?? Weiss is just bought Gurna Industries. Ugh, so passe,'), but you could flesh out the system almost indefinitely.
